2011 Updates

January
  • We provide employees a single site to track both the money and the time they give to charitable organizations. This improves reporting and helps people manage all their personal charitable efforts in one place.
February
  • With PerkShare, a new service on progressive.com, we offer a variety of vehicle-related discounts and benefits whether you’re a customer or not so you can start saving money even before you get a quote.
March
  • InformationWeek magazine ranks Progressive near the top of its InformationWeek 500, an annual ranking of the country's most innovative users of business technology.
  • For 2010-2011, we receive a BURNING HOT rating on OUT for Work’s HOT (Hiring Out Talent) list. Companies are rated based on level of anticipated entry hires for the year and workplace equality for LGBT employees.
  • We begin national advertising for our Snapshot Discount, an industry-leading Pay As You Drive® program that offers good drivers the chance to lower their car insurance rates by as much as 30 percent based on real-time analysis of their driving habits.
  • Commercial Lines customers can now choose Pet Injury coverage so their beloved, four-legged companions who tag along in their vehicles are covered the same as our Auto, RV and Boat customers.
